The historical evolution of the Russian railway technical operation rules

Abstract

Relevance. For almost two centuries, rail transport has been and remains one of the key means of transportation. Due to this, it is necessary to ensure traffic safety, which should be reflected in the basic rules applicable to railway transport. This article is devoted to the analysis of the rules of technical operation of railway transport from the end of the XIX century to the present. The development of railway techniques and technologies reflects not only progress in the engineering and technical fields, but also the vast context of social, economic, political and scientific changes. The study of the evolution of the rules of technical operation allows us to trace these changes and draw conclusions about how scientific and technical innovations were formed and introduced into the practice of railway transport.

Purpose of the study is to study the evolution of the rules of technical operation of Russian railway transport in different periods of time.

Objective is to conduct a comparative analysis of the evolution of the rules of technical operation of railway transport from the end of the XIX century to the present to identify changes in the basic requirements for safety and technical characteristics, to identify the causes of changes and the influence of political, economic and technological factors on the formation of these rules; to assess the role of changes in the context of the development of the railway system.

Methodology. The research is based on the principles of objectivity and historicism. To solve the tasks set, such methods as historical-comparative, historical-genetic, historical-typological were used.

Results. A comparison of the provisions of the rules of technical operation of railways made it possible to objectively assess the impact of scientific and technological progress in the field of railway transport on the formation and strengthening of regulatory and technical traffic safety.

Conclusion. The author came to the conclusion that the rules of technical operation of railways have undergone a number of changes, innovations, exceptions and improvements over their history, but many provisions remain unchanged to this day. The accumulated operational, technical and normative experience is necessary for further improvement of the safety system in Russian railway transport.
